Yazam Ole Programme

Integration in Israel through entrepreneurship

Yazam Ole helps new immigrants settle into Israel through the creation of a new business or the development of an existing one.

Features of the programme

Yazam Ole combines learning, the development of a real business, and integration into Israeli society.

Participants immediately apply what they learn to their own projects and test it through interaction with local people and organisations.

Project

During the programme, participants find and develop a new business idea; test whether a business created in their country of origin can work in Israel and adapt it to the local market where necessary; develop a new line of activity within an existing business; or, by mutual agreement, join another participant’s project in a clearly defined role.

Hands-on practice

The participant works on a project during and between classes in a real environment: talking to people, testing hypotheses, looking for clients and partners, developing and refining the product, business model, financial model and MVP.

Participants whose projects are ready for launch conduct the first controlled launch with the support of the programme team.

Integration

Through this work, participants learn how Israeli culture and business relationships operate, expand their local networks, and apply their professional experience in an Israeli context.

How the programme works

Work proceeds in recurring weekly cycles. The overall route is shared, while each specific step depends on the participant’s project and starting point.

  1. 01

    Learn

    Learn new material or a new tool

  2. 02

    Prepare

    Define the next practical step

  3. 03

    Act

    Work with people, the market, and the project

  4. 04

    Review

    Compare the outcome with expectations

  5. 05

    Refine

    Adjust the solution and continue

What is the result of the programme?

The programme has two interconnected outcomes: changes in the participant’s adaptation and the outcome of their work on a business project.

The entrepreneurial outcome may take one of three forms.

Outcome 1

Completed the learning path

The tools have been mastered, the stages have been completed, and the experience can be applied to the next idea.

Outcome 2

The project is ready for launch

The project has been assembled, the initial conditions are clear, the decision to launch can be postponed.

Outcome 3

Programme completed in full

Conducted a controlled launch and received predetermined market action.
